Background
The mushroom is an edible fungus, the generally edible part is a mushroom fruiting body, and fresh mushrooms are dehydrated to form dry mushrooms which are convenient to transport and store and are important goods in south and north China.
But mushroom drying device on the existing market when drying the mushroom, generally all heats the mushroom through a heat source and dries, and the stoving dynamics is less, to a certain extent, has influenced the drying efficiency of mushroom, and in addition, current mushroom drying device is when drying the mushroom, and the mushroom piles up together easily, causes the mushroom to dry unevenly and the mushroom is dried inadequately.

Detailed Description
The following detailed description of the present invention is provided in conjunction with the accompanying drawings, but it should be understood that the scope of the present invention is not limited by the following detailed description.
The specific implementation manner of the utility model is as follows:
in the first embodiment, as shown in fig. 1 and 2, a mushroom drying device comprises a supporting seat 1, so that the mushroom drying device has better structural stability, the top of the supporting seat 1 is fixedly connected with an installation platform 2 and a drying box 3, a heating furnace 4 is installed at the top of the installation platform 2, so as to heat mushrooms inside the drying box 3, an air duct 5 is fixedly connected between the heating furnace 4 and the drying box 3, one side of the drying box 3 is provided with a first installation groove, a motor 6 is fixedly connected inside the first installation groove, so as to drive a drying cylinder 8 to rotate, so as to prevent the mushrooms from being stacked together in the drying process, an output shaft of the motor 6 is fixedly connected with a rotating rod 7 through a first bearing embedded at one side of the drying box 3, one end of the rotating rod 7 is movably connected with the drying box 3 through a second bearing embedded at the other side of the drying box 3, fixedly connected with stoving section of thick bamboo 8 on the bull stick 7, the second mounting groove has been seted up on the inside top of stoving box 3, and the internally mounted of second mounting groove has electric heating net 9, further heats the mushroom, has played the effect of raising the efficiency.
Embodiment two, on the basis of embodiment one, given by fig. 1 and 2, annular spout has all been seted up to the inside both sides of stoving box 3, and the equal fixedly connected with bracing piece 10 in top and the bottom of a stoving section of thick bamboo 8 both sides, bracing piece 10 and annular spout sliding connection have played better supporting role to a stoving section of thick bamboo 8, have improved its stability.
In the third embodiment, on the basis of the first embodiment, as shown in fig. 1, a water outlet 11 is formed in one side of the bottom of the drying box body 3, and a cover is connected to the bottom end of the water outlet 11 in a threaded manner, so that moisture evaporated from the mushrooms can be conveniently discharged.
Fourth embodiment, on the basis of the first embodiment, as shown in fig. 1 and 3, the front surface of the drying cylinder 8 is movably connected with a first door 12 through a first rotating shaft, the first door 12 is fixedly connected with a knob 15, the front surface of the drying box body 3 is movably connected with a second door 13 through a second rotating shaft, and the second door 13 is fixedly connected with a handle 16, so that the worker can conveniently place the mushrooms inside the drying cylinder 8.
In the fifth embodiment, based on the first embodiment, as shown in fig. 2, a heat insulating pad 14 is fixedly connected to the outer side of the drying box 3, and the heat insulating pad 14 is made of asbestos material, so that the drying box 3 has a good heat insulating effect and prevents heat from being dissipated outside.
Sixth embodiment, on the basis of the first embodiment, as shown in fig. 1 and 2, the front surface of the supporting seat 1 is provided with a first control switch and a second control switch, and the motor 6 and the electric heating net 9 are respectively electrically connected with an external power supply through the first control switch and the second control switch, so that a worker can conveniently control the working states of the motor 6 and the electric heating net 9.
In this embodiment: the motor 6 adopts a YH802-2 type motor.
The working principle is as follows: when the mushroom drying box works, the second box door 13 and the first box door 12 are opened in sequence, mushrooms are placed in the drying cylinder 8, the second box door 13 and the first box door 12 are closed, the heating furnace 4 and the electric heating net 9 are started to heat and dry the mushrooms, meanwhile, the first control switch is pressed, the motor 6 drives the drying cylinder 8 to rotate, so that the mushrooms are prevented from being stacked together during drying, the mushrooms are dried more uniformly and sufficiently, after the drying is finished, the heating furnace 4, the electric heating net 9 and the motor 6 are stopped to work, the cover is opened, evaporated moisture is discharged through the water outlet 11, the annular sliding grooves formed in two sides inside the drying box body 3 and the supporting rods 10 fixedly connected with the top and the bottom of the drying cylinder 8 play a better supporting role in supporting the drying cylinder 8, the stability of the drying box body is improved, the heat insulation pad 14 fixedly connected with the outer side of the drying box body 3 is fixedly connected with the outer side of the drying box body 3, so that the drying box body, preventing heat from being dissipated.
